Donald Trump threatened to cut federal funds to California if a transgender student is not prevented from participating in a women’s sports competition.

The controversy involves Ab Hernandez, a 16 -year high school student, whose participation in an athletics championship generated a national debate on the inclusion of trans athletes in the sport.

Since 2013, has a state law that allows transgender athletes to compete for competitions according to the genre with which they identify themselves. However, Trump, who prohibited the participation of trans athletes in women’s championships during his term, now requires the state to comply with this measure.

Changes in competition and reactions

In response to the controversy, the federation that regulates high school sports in California implemented new policies.

If a trans athlete qualifies for a final, an additional vacancy will open to a cisgender athlete. Also, if the trans athlete wins a podium position, two medals will be delivered – one for her and one for the next classified cisgender athlete.

The California governor considered these changes a “reasonable commitment.” On the other hand, conservative groups such as California Family Council, a conservative organization, argue that these measures ignore fundamental biological differences between men and women.

The United States Department of Justice is investigating whether the California State Law violates title IX, which prohibits gender discrimination in educational institutions that receive federal funds.

While the debate continues, Ab Hernandez and his mother defend the young woman’s right to participate in sports, stating that she is a girl and identifies herself as such.

Her athletics team supports her and treats like any other athlete, demonstrating that support for inclusion comes from inside the team itself.
